Go to the Centrale or Cadorna railway station, get a ticket to Como S, Giovanni or to Varenna-Esino, stamp it and leave.

When you are on the Lake take a ferry for a couple of hours, look around for George&Friends and you are done with the lake. If you are in the city of Como, take the funicular to Brunate for an amazing view of the lake and the alps.

To expand on this topic, I would suggest that you purchase round trip tickets to Varenna-Esino at Milano Centrale train station. Be sure to validate your ticket at the machine on the platform. You can ask someone where it is specifically. ( We did.) Sit on the left side of the train for the best scenery. When you arrive in Varenna, walk down the hill to the shore and stroll the promanade from the ferry dock to the cafes. Investigate ahead of time Varenna Taxi boat tours, and schedule an early afternoon group tour of the mid lake region. This is a 2 1/2 hour tour that will also take you to Villa Balbianello (cost of the Villa tour included in the boat tour price---about 60 euros when we did it in May) When I went online to rebook this tour, they offered it every day but Mon and Wed. The views from the water of the Alps and the villages hugging the coast is gorgeous. The boat will bring you back to their dock in Varenna where you can stroll down to one of the outside cafes for a drink or a meal and just take in the beauty of this charming place, Walk back up to the train station (having checked the departure time that fits your schedule), validate your ticket, board and take all those pleasant memories back with you to Milan!
